Optical Superiority

nav-comm engineers have developed a unique beam pattern for the Eclipse LED light pods. 3 crafted optical lenses are used to project light where it is needed most. A High intensity central narrow beam flanked by two wide angle beams. This increases the visibility at junctions. The rear protection visibility is vastly improved when the Emergency vehicle is parked at an angle.
Unlike traditional light sources, LED's radiate a narrow, colour-specific wavelength of light. This light requires no colour filtering or tinted lenses, so none of the emitted light is wasted and it's capable of being seen at great distances in poor or foggy weather.

Efficiency
LED's produce more candle power per watt of energy than any other lighting technology used on emergency vehicles such as strobes or halogen. This means a far lower electrical power demand upon an emergency vehicle, giving you the freedom to let your lights run without running your engine or having to reduce the number of lights operating. An added safety feature: Because of their effective energy handling, LED products don’t emit the relatively high amounts of radiated heat that strobes and halogen bulbs do and don't require heavy power cables.
